Boilers are one of the most crucial parts of any house, giving heat and hot water all year long. Therefore any issues really need to be dealt with previous to becoming a significant problem.

In the heart of winter it can cost a minimum of £200 just in call-out expenses for an engineer. This is prior to cost of replacing pieces.

To avoid spending a significant amount of money, make certain to have your boiler serviced yearly so any issues could be detected as soon as possible. Besides this, having a service will make sure your central heating boiler is operating efficiently, lowering your expenses.

The service will also showcase any danger too, such as a carbon monoxide leak. Carbon monoxide poisoning is responsible for 100s of deaths and hospitalisations yearly, so make certain this doesn't happen to you.

Average Boiler repair and service cost in Sowerby Bridge

The regular cost of a boiler service is around £72, but you could pay anything between £58 and £100. The regular cost of a repair is £182 a time, but it depends on the repair. The regular cost of a replacement gas valve or expansion vessel, for example, is £300 each, plus labour of about £50 per hour. National companies may charge more than small local companies since they have more overheads. You’ll also find seasonal differences, as companies charge less in the summer when they are less busy than in the winter when they have lots of work.

Sowerby Bridge is a market community in the Upper Calder Valley in Calderdale in West Yorkshire, England. The town was originally a fording point over the once much-wider River Calder where it signs up with the River Ryburn, and also it takes its name from the historic bridge which spans the river in the town centre. Sowerby Bridge is located concerning 3 miles (4.8 km) from Halifax town centre. It is at the convergence of the River Calder and River Ryburn, and also the name Sowerby Bridge recommendations its circumstance as a crossing point over the River Calder to the older settlement at Sowerby. The town is additionally at the junction of the Calder and Hebble Navigation and also the Rochdale Canal. Tuel Lane Lock on the Rochdale Canal is the deepest secure the UK. The canal basin as well as storehouses where the canals meet, Sowerby Bridge Wharf, are provided structures as well as house the Moorings Bar and Restaurant, 12-04 Restaurant and also Temujin Mongolian Dining Establishment. The basin is the head office of the 12th Halifax Sea Precursors (M.o.D. No. 54 Royal Navy acknowledged) where Prince Charles opened up the William Andrew Memorial Headquarters. Shire Cruisers run holiday hire canal barges, develop slim boats and give mooring facilities. The Calderdale Council ward population at the 2011 census was 11,703. Homeowners have a number of recreation facilities readily available to them in the town, including stores, dining establishments and sport centres. Rushbearing, the annual event of taking rushes to churches for covering the floorings throughout winter, still occurs below over the first weekend of September. How to service a boiler?

During a boiler service, your boiler engineer will perform a series of checks to ensure that your boiler is safe and efficient. First, they will conduct a visual inspection to check for any corrosion or leaks. They will also check the flame in your boiler. They’ll then remove the boiler casing and check all the components, including the heat exchanger, burner and spark probe, then clean the inside. After this, they’ll check the flue for obstructions and ensure that it’s safely fitted. They will then do a gas pressure check to ensure the boiler is working at the right pressure, before firing it up to check for any working faults.

How to repair a boiler leak?

If your boiler is leaking, there are some checks that you can do yourself. However, you should never attempt to repair your boiler yourself – only a Gas Safe-registered engineer should conduct repairs.

There are 3 main reasons why your boiler might be leaking: there’s a pressure valve fault, a temperature valve leak or corrosion in the system. An engineer will be able to spot the problem quickly, but in the meantime there are a few things you can do:

Check the pipe fittings

If your boiler is leaking water around the pipe fittings, it could be an installation fault and you should get in touch with the engineer that fitted it. You can check the pipe fittings by drying the area then waiting to see if the water appears again. If it does, you may be able to do a ¼ turn of the pipe to stop it. However, you should still call the engineer that installed it to ask them to check the PTFE tape on the inside.

Inspect the seals

Over time, the rubber seals on a boiler can start to perish, so if you have an old boiler this could be the source of your leak. If you have a new boiler, it could be caused by your boiler running over pressure.

Heat exchanger corrosion

Unfortunately, if a boiler engineer discovers that the boiler is leaking water from the heat exchanger, this is the end of the road for your system. The heat exchanger is the most expensive part of your boiler, so it makes more financial sense to replace your boiler with a newer, more efficient model rather than try to replace it.

How Often To Service Boiler?

A boiler is a vital part of any home especially if you’re in the UK. Not only does provide your entire household with hot water and keep them warm but also adds a good value to your property. Boiler repairs and replacement are both super expensive and stressful, so in order to avoid all these worries, it’s better to have your boiler serviced on a regular basis for your own peace of mind. When you call in a reliable heating engineer, it can immensely raise your boiler’s efficiency while also saving you from more expensive issues down the road.

So if you haven’t had your boiler serviced for quite some time, moved into a new house and not aware the last time your boiler was serviced or perhaps you’re just wondering how often a boiler should be serviced, then you’ve come to the right place! The short and simple answer to this question is a boiler should should be serviced once in a year, and most preferably during the summer months. However, there are a wide range of factors that comes into play so it’s always advisable to check with your manufacturer before you proceed.

According to the law, you’re required to have your boiler services on an annual basis. Failure to do so can render your boiler or home warranty void. Therefore, it’s very crucial to take down the last time your boiler was serviced and also set a reminder to book your next appointment when the time closes in.

If you happen to own an electric boiler you may not need an annual servicing. But you may still be required to perform it annually by your insurance provider.
